掌握 PHP 语言:推荐五本优秀的 PHP 书籍

PHP 语言在如今万维网信息爆炸的时代中越来越受欢迎。PHP 被广泛用于 web 开发,它简单易懂,上手快,免费并且可以在任何操作系统上运行。因此,学习 PHP 已经成为不少程序员的首选。不过,想要成为一名优秀的 PHP 程序员,必须要掌握全面的基础知识和高级技巧。要想学好 PHP 语言,阅读书籍是必不可少的学习方式。在这里,我会推荐五本优秀的 PHP 书籍,这些书籍涵盖了 PHP 的不同方面,可以帮助你更快更好地掌握 PHP 语言。

1. 《PHP 和 MySQL Web 开发》

这本书由 Luke Welling 和 Laura Thomson 合著,是 PHP 和 MySQL 领域最具有代表性的书籍之一。此书系统介绍了基于 PHP 和 MySQL 的 Web 开发的方方面面,包括安装和配置 PHP 和 MySQL,PHP 程序的基础知识,Web 表单处理,数据库概念及其在 Web 开发中的应用,安全性和错误处理等等。此书易于理解,非常适合初学者阅读,同时中级和高级开发人员也可以从中获益。

2. 《高性能 MySQL》

这本书作者是 Baron Schwartz、Vadim Tkachenko 和 Peter Zaitsev,是 MySQL 领域的杰出代表。虽然这本书不仅仅是讲 PHP,但 MySQL 是 PHP Web 开发中广泛使用的数据库管理系统,理解 MySQL 的基础和高级特性对于开发高质量的 PHP 应用程序至关重要。这本书详细介绍了 MySQL 中的性能优化,并提供了一些有用的工具和技巧,以帮助PHP程序员构建更快、更可靠的Web应用程序。

3. 《PHP 设计模式》

设计模式是一种被普遍应用于软件工程中的概念,它帮助开发人员解决长期存在而又常见的编程问题。设计模式为 PHP 开发人员提供了一种通用的问题解决方法,帮助我们编写出更好的、更易于维护的代码。这本书由 Jason E. Sweat 合著,介绍了 16 种最常用的设计模式,并提供了许多能帮助你深入理解每个模式的例子。

4. 《PHP 内核剖析》

php书籍

对于 PHP 工程师来说,了解 PHP 内核是非常重要的,特别是当遇到深层次的问题时。这本书作者是 Sara Golemon,她在 PHP 核心开发团队中有多年经验。此书的主要内容是 PHP 前世今生的发展历程,以及 PHP 内核的核心代码解析。通过这本书,你可以理解背后的原理和细节,从而获得更独立、更自信的编码技巧。

5. 《效率教科书:高效 PHP 编程》

高效的编程技巧是开发人员必不可少的技能之一。该书作者是 Alessandro F. Garbagnati,和 PHP 核心开发成员 Francesco Marchioni。此书介绍了多种高效编码策略,从优化 PHP 系统、提升 PHP 程序效率、选择性加载和缓存到编写高效 SQL 查询等,这些技巧可以帮助开发人员优化其PHP应用程序,并提高代码的可维护性。

以上就是五本值得推荐的 PHP 书籍。通过阅读这些书籍,你将更好地掌握 PHP 语言,从而编写出更健壮、更高效、更易于维护的应用程序。无论是初学者还是中级开发人员都可以从这些书籍中获益。

关键词:PHPMySQL设计模式